If you’re a team admin and you’re currently subscribed to a Dropbox Business plan, this article will tell you how to cancel Dropbox Business and downgrade yourself to the Dropbox Basic plan.
If you’re a team member, contact your team admin.

You will be taken to a webpage titled You have successfully cancelled your Dropbox Business account.
To confirm your Dropbox Business cancellation, go to the billing page of the admin console at https://www.dropbox.com/team/admin/billing. There will be a notification box at the top that says You are scheduled to cancel Dropbox Business on [date].
When you cancel Dropbox Business, your plan change doesn’t immediately reflect on your Dropbox Business team or account. You finish using any amount of time with Dropbox Business that you’ve already paid for. At the end of your billing cycle, you’ll be downgraded to Basic and you won’t be charged again.
When you cancel Dropbox Business, your team is placed into a locked state at the end of your subscription, which allows the team to continue access to the team files, but removes most team syncing and sharing features. You can disband your team to remove all team access.

Find your current Dropbox plan
If you’re not sure what type of account you have right now, sign in to Dropbox and go to https://www.dropbox.com/account/plan, or follow these instructions.
In most cases, Dropbox plans are non-refundable. If you think there’s been an error in billing, please contact our support team and we’ll work with you to find a solution.
